Job summary

AdventHealth in Ocala, FL is seeking a Pharmacist to educate patients and care teams on safe medication use, participate in stewardship and rounds, and ensure safe transitions from admission to discharge.

The role requires a PharmD and Florida licensure with 1+ year hospital experience preferred; leadership of technicians and ongoing professional development are part of the responsibilities.

Qualifications

  • PharmD degree required for licensure.
  • Licensed Pharmacist (RPH) with active Florida license.
  • Hospital pharmacy experience preferred (1+ year).

Responsibilities

  • Educate and counsel patients, families, and healthcare team on safe medication use.
  • Provide safe, timely, and cost-effective medication therapy; participate in stewardship, surveillance, and restricted-use programs.
  • Engage in direct patient care and interdisciplinary rounds; ensure smooth transitions of care from admission to discharge and follow-up.
  • Supervise, mentor, and evaluate pharmacy technicians, interns, and residents; support team learning and development.
  • Identify, report, and help resolve medication safety events, adverse drug reactions, and errors.
